I will forever have a &lt;span style=&quot;font-style: italic; color: rgb(255, 204, 255);&quot;&gt;thing &lt;/span&gt;for sharp knives.&lt;br&gt;&lt;br&gt;I spent a lot of time baking bread when I was in college. Chef Tan and I were the only ones who took baking seriously and I would spend my extra hours kneading dough and dumping huge amounts of flour into the industrial mixer. A lot of my tools, like the &lt;span style=&quot;color: rgb(204, 255, 255);&quot;&gt;2 scrapers&lt;/span&gt; (&lt;span style=&quot;font-style: italic;&quot;&gt;bottom left corner&lt;/span&gt;), &lt;span style=&quot;color: rgb(204, 255, 255);&quot;&gt;spatulas&lt;/span&gt; (&lt;span style=&quot;font-style: italic;&quot;&gt;top right corner&lt;/span&gt;), and &lt;span style=&quot;color: rgb(204, 255, 255);&quot;&gt;circular dough cutter &lt;/span&gt;served my bread making purposes. There's nothing quite like the art of baking bread. People say that baking pastries and baking bread are the same thing. What a misconception!!! Bread making is an exact science, that can be tweaked after laborious hours experimenting for the right temperature, the right amount of sugar or salt, the right angle for the razor blade to achieve the perfect grin, how many ice cubes goes into the oven, do you use a stone plate oven, or a combi oven, basket or no basket? Each baker has his or her own tricks, her own formula.&amp;nbsp; If there's one thing I miss about cooking, it's baking. I miss the smell of fresh bread out of the oven, and waiting eagerly for the dough to ferment to yield one of nature's most simple delicacies. &lt;br&gt;&lt;br&gt;The two &lt;span style=&quot;color: rgb(204, 255, 255);&quot;&gt;ring moulds&lt;/span&gt; were mostly used for presentation purposes, for moulding appetizers and getting that stacked height that was all the rage years ago. The &lt;span style=&quot;color: rgb(204, 255, 255);&quot;&gt;cloth filter&lt;/span&gt; was used for the pain staking &lt;span style=&quot;color: rgb(255, 204, 255);&quot;&gt;consommé&lt;/span&gt;&lt;/font&gt;&lt;font size=&quot;1&quot;&gt; process. All that trouble for a crystal clear broth! &lt;/font&gt;&lt;font size=&quot;1&quot;&gt;I remember doing a smoked tomato &lt;/font&gt;&lt;font size=&quot;1&quot;&gt;consommé, which involved smoking plum tomatoes over smoldering wood chips and tea leaves on a hot plate, then turning it into soup with the mirepoix mixture and finely minced chicken breasts, and using egg whites to clarify the soup. We had to then continuously skim the floating crap out of the soup and eventually remove all the stuff that we had added and what is left is just tomato water. Then begins the tedious process of sieving the broth through layers and layers of &lt;span style=&quot;color: rgb(204, 255, 255);&quot;&gt;cloth filter&lt;/span&gt;, ladle by ladle to achieve the crystal clear &lt;/font&gt;&lt;font size=&quot;1&quot;&gt;consommé&lt;/font&gt;&lt;font size=&quot;1&quot;&gt;. It looked like water, because for some reason, the liquid loses colour after the filtering process - the end result is sometimes called an '&lt;span style=&quot;color: rgb(255, 204, 255);&quot;&gt;essence&lt;/span&gt;'. Add some gelatin and you get a &lt;span style=&quot;color: rgb(255, 204, 255);&quot;&gt;gel&lt;/span&gt;&lt;/font&gt;&lt;font style=&quot;color: rgb(255, 204, 255);&quot; size=&quot;1&quot;&gt;é&lt;/font&gt;&lt;font size=&quot;1&quot;&gt;&lt;span style=&quot;color: rgb(255, 204, 255);&quot;&gt;e&lt;/span&gt;!&lt;br&gt;&lt;br&gt;The needle like instrument is called a &lt;span style=&quot;color: rgb(204, 255, 255);&quot;&gt;trussing needle&lt;/span&gt;, used for tying up the roast meat and poultry so they hold their shape. Which is why some steaks are unnaturally round and whole roast chickens always look so plump and 'together'. I don't know if you can actually use a trussing needle for sewing, but I imagine that it's sharp enough to go through some pretty heavy fabric. The &lt;span style=&quot;color: rgb(204, 255, 255);&quot;&gt;syringe &lt;/span&gt;was used for adding flavoured '&lt;span style=&quot;color: rgb(255, 204, 255);&quot;&gt;oils&lt;/span&gt;' to soups. I had a special &lt;span style=&quot;color: rgb(204, 255, 255);&quot;&gt;tube with a extra fine nozzle&lt;/span&gt; for doing dots or lines on plated items. My favourite base was a &lt;span style=&quot;color: rgb(255, 204, 255);&quot;&gt;balsamic reduction&lt;/span&gt; with its dark colour and syrup like consistency. &lt;br&gt;&lt;br&gt;Now, let me tell you about my babies. The smallest being my most treasured - the &lt;span style=&quot;color: rgb(204, 255, 255);&quot;&gt;paring knife&lt;/span&gt;. I used it for almost everything. This was also the most frequently stolen item in the kitchen as someone else's paring knife was always in a 'better' condition than your own. So to prevent paring knife theft - I engraved my initials on to my set of knives. Problem solved. No one dared to touch my knives, or they risked losing an appendage. The knife set comes with &lt;span style=&quot;color: rgb(204, 255, 255);&quot;&gt;a butcher knife&lt;/span&gt; (&lt;span style=&quot;font-style: italic;&quot;&gt;4th from the bottom right&lt;/span&gt;), a flexible &lt;span style=&quot;color: rgb(204, 255, 255);&quot;&gt;fish knife&lt;/span&gt;, two chef's knives (one big and one smaller one), and a paring knife. Of course, over time, this collection has grown to include all sorts of speciality knives - a &lt;span style=&quot;color: rgb(204, 255, 255);&quot;&gt;bread knife&lt;/span&gt;, and a t&lt;span style=&quot;color: rgb(204, 255, 255);&quot;&gt;ourning knife&lt;/span&gt; for the dreaded tourn&lt;/font&gt;&lt;font size=&quot;1&quot;&gt;é&lt;/font&gt;&lt;font size=&quot;1&quot;&gt;e potatoes/carrots. &lt;br&gt;&lt;br&gt;I've always dreamed of owning a set of GLOBAL knives, well knowned for being the sharpest knives on the block, these bad babies can cost about a 1000 bucks each, depending on the size. Apparently they are forged using the same metal alloys as samurai swords, resulting in a super light weight sharp ass blade. If you don't possess ninja-like knife skills - I guarantee that you &lt;span style=&quot;font-weight: bold;&quot;&gt;WILL &lt;/span&gt;definitely hurt&amp;nbsp; yourself. &lt;br&gt;&lt;br&gt;&lt;/font&gt;&lt;div style=&quot;text-align: center;&quot;&gt;&lt;font size=&quot;1&quot;&gt;&lt;img style=&quot;width: 210px; height: 210px;&quot; src=&quot;http://i61.photobucket.com/albums/h59/digitaldream3r/GlobalKnives.jpg&quot;&gt;&lt;img style=&quot;width: 244px; height: 210px;&quot; src=&quot;http://i61.photobucket.com/albums/h59/digitaldream3r/mandolin.jpg&quot;&gt;&lt;/font&gt;&lt;br&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;font size=&quot;1&quot;&gt;&lt;br&gt;And who can forget the &lt;span style=&quot;color: rgb(204, 255, 255);&quot;&gt;mandoline&lt;/span&gt;?
